lichess.org
Donate
FEN
[Event "rated classical game"] [Site "https://lichess.org/EEG0ougO"] [Date "2025.11.13"] [Round "-"] [White "SonnyHayes"] [Black "yudong"] [Result "0-1"] [GameId "EEG0ougO"] [UTCDate "2025.11.13"] [UTCTime "15:20:01"] [WhiteElo "1458"] [BlackElo "2173"] [WhiteRatingDiff "-27"] [BlackRatingDiff "+13"] [Variant "Standard"] [TimeControl "1800+10"] [ECO "C02"] [Opening "French Defense: Advance Variation, Milner-Barry Gambit, Hector Variation"] [Termination "Normal"] [Annotator "lichess.org"] 1. e4 { [%eval 0.18] } 1... e6 { [%eval 0.22] } 2. d4 { [%eval 0.29] } 2... d5 { [%eval 0.31] } 3. e5 { [%eval 0.25] } 3... c5 { [%eval 0.2] } 4. c3 { [%eval 0.18] } 4... Nc6 { [%eval 0.11] } 5. Nf3 { [%eval 0.15] } 5... Qb6 { [%eval 0.22] } 6. Bd3 { [%eval 0.0] } 6... cxd4 { [%eval 0.0] } 7. O-O { [%eval 0.0] } 7... Bd7 { [%eval 0.04] } 8. Re1 { [%eval 0.29] } { C02 French Defense: Advance Variation, Milner-Barry Gambit, Hector Variation } 8... Nge7 { [%eval 0.24] } 9. h4 { [%eval 0.21] } 9... h6 { [%eval 0.26] } 10. h5 { [%eval 0.31] } 10... O-O-O? { (0.31 → 1.44) Mistake. Rc8 was best. } { [%eval 1.44] } (10... Rc8 11. Nbd2) 11. Nbd2?! { (1.44 → 0.53) Inaccuracy. a4 was best. } { [%eval 0.53] } (11. a4) 11... f6 { [%eval 0.69] } 12. a4? { (0.69 → -0.52) Mistake. cxd4 was best. } { [%eval -0.52] } (12. cxd4) 12... fxe5 { [%eval -0.48] } 13. Nxe5 { [%eval -0.59] } 13... Nxe5 { [%eval -0.61] } 14. Rxe5 { [%eval -0.33] } 14... Nc6 { [%eval -0.45] } 15. Re1 { [%eval -0.38] } 15... e5 { [%eval -0.52] } 16. a5 { [%eval -0.57] } 16... Qc7 { [%eval -0.22] } 17. a6 { [%eval -0.44] } 17... b6 { [%eval -0.4] } 18. cxd4 { [%eval -0.45] } 18... Nxd4?! { (-0.45 → 0.48) Inaccuracy. Bb4 was best. } { [%eval 0.48] } (18... Bb4) 19. Nb3 { [%eval 0.49] } 19... Bb4?! { (0.49 → 1.52) Inaccuracy. Nc6 was best. } { [%eval 1.52] } (19... Nc6) 20. Bd2? { (1.52 → 0.00) Mistake. Nxd4 was best. } { [%eval 0.0] } (20. Nxd4) 20... Nxb3 { [%eval 0.03] } 21. Bxb4 { [%eval 0.07] } 21... Nxa1 { [%eval 0.24] } 22. Qxa1 { [%eval 0.0] } 22... Kb8 { [%eval 0.05] } 23. Rc1 { [%eval 0.1] } 23... Bc6 { [%eval 0.2] } 24. Bb5 { [%eval 0.2] } 24... Bxb5 { [%eval 0.12] } 25. Rxc7 { [%eval 0.15] } 25... Kxc7 { [%eval 0.24] } 26. Qc1+ { [%eval 0.0] } 26... Kb8 { [%eval 0.0] } 27. Qe3 { [%eval -0.11] } 27... Rhe8 { [%eval -0.13] } 28. Qg3 { [%eval -0.15] } 28... Rd7 { [%eval -0.2] } 29. f4 { [%eval -0.19] } 29... exf4 { [%eval -0.06] } 30. Qxf4+?! { (-0.06 → -1.14) Inaccuracy. Qg6 was best. } { [%eval -1.14] } (30. Qg6) 30... Ka8 { [%eval -1.14] } 31. Qf5 { [%eval -1.35] } 31... Red8? { (-1.35 → 0.00) Mistake. Rdd8 was best. } { [%eval 0.0] } (31... Rdd8 32. Bc3) 32. Bc3?? { (0.00 → -2.43) Blunder. Be1 was best. } { [%eval -2.43] } (32. Be1 Bxa6 33. Bh4 Bb5 34. Bxd8 Rxd8 35. g4 a6 36. Kf2 d4 37. Ke1 Rd7) 32... Bxa6 { [%eval -2.3] } 33. Bd4 { [%eval -2.19] } 33... Bb7? { (-2.19 → -0.91) Mistake. Kb7 was best. } { [%eval -0.91] } (33... Kb7) 34. b4? { (-0.91 → -2.20) Mistake. Qd3 was best. } { [%eval -2.2] } (34. Qd3 Rc7) 34... Bc6?? { (-2.20 → -0.45) Blunder. Ba6 was best. } { [%eval -0.45] } (34... Ba6) 35. Qe6?? { (-0.45 → -2.34) Blunder. Qd3 was best. } { [%eval -2.34] } (35. Qd3) 35... Kb7 { [%eval -2.12] } 36. Qe2 { [%eval -1.95] } 36... Rf7?! { (-1.95 → -1.16) Inaccuracy. Ba4 was best. } { [%eval -1.16] } (36... Ba4 37. Qb2 Rc8 38. Qa3 Bb5 39. Qg3 Rc1+ 40. Kh2 Rc4 41. Bxg7) 37. b5 { [%eval -1.4] } 37... Bd7 { [%eval -1.07] } 38. Qd3 { [%eval -1.12] } 38... Bf5?! { (-1.12 → -0.07) Inaccuracy. Rf5 was best. } { [%eval -0.07] } (38... Rf5 39. Be3 Rdf8 40. g4 Re5 41. Qd4 Rfe8 42. Bf4 Re1+ 43. Kf2 Bxb5 44. Qxg7+) 39. Qc3 { [%eval -0.48] } 39... Rc8 { [%eval 0.0] } 40. Qa1?? { (0.00 → -3.38) Blunder. Qf3 was best. } { [%eval -3.38] } (40. Qf3 Rd8 41. Kh2 Rdd7 42. Qa3 Kc8 43. Bf2 Be4 44. Bg3 Kd8 45. Qc3 Ke8) 40... Rc2 { [%eval -2.82] } 41. Qa6+ { [%eval -2.6] } 41... Kb8 { [%eval -2.2] } 42. Be5+?! { (-2.20 → -3.30) Inaccuracy. Qa3 was best. } { [%eval -3.3] } (42. Qa3 Be4 43. Qd6+ Kb7 44. Kh2 g5 45. hxg6 Rxg2+ 46. Kh3 Rxg6 47. Qd8 Re6) 42... Ka8 { [%eval -2.99] } 43. g3?? { (-2.99 → -7.79) Blunder. Bf4 was best. } { [%eval -7.79] } (43. Bf4 Be4 44. g3 Rf8 45. Qa3 Re8 46. Qd6 d4 47. Qxd4 Bb7 48. Bd2 Rc5) 43... Be4?? { (-7.79 → -2.99) Blunder. Rc1+ was best. } { [%eval -2.99] } (43... Rc1+ 44. Kf2 Bc8+ 45. Ke3 Bxa6 46. Kd2 Bxb5 47. Kxc1 Re7 48. Bd6 Rd7 49. Be5) 44. Bf4 { [%eval -2.79] } 44... Rf8 { [%eval -2.47] } 45. Qa3 { [%eval -2.44] } 45... Rfc8 { [%eval -2.34] } 46. Qe7 { [%eval -2.23] } 46... Rb2 { [%eval -2.23] } 47. Qxg7 { [%eval -2.18] } 47... Rxb5 { [%eval -2.3] } 48. Qxh6? { (-2.30 → -4.06) Mistake. Kh2 was best. } { [%eval -4.06] } (48. Kh2 Rb1) 48... Rc2 { [%eval -3.57] } 49. Qh8+ { [%eval -4.26] } 49... Kb7 { [%eval -4.49] } 50. Qg7+?! { (-4.49 → -6.26) Inaccuracy. Qb8+ was best. } { [%eval -6.26] } (50. Qb8+ Ka6 51. Bd2 Rb1+ 52. Kf2 Rxd2+ 53. Ke3 Rc2 54. g4 Rc4 55. Qe5 Rb3+) 50... Ka6 { [%eval -6.21] } 51. Qa1+ { [%eval -5.7] } 51... Ra5 { [%eval -5.5] } 52. Qg7?! { (-5.50 → -7.27) Inaccuracy. Qf1+ was best. } { [%eval -7.27] } (52. Qf1+ Kb7) 52... Raa2 { [%eval -6.81] } 53. Kf1?? { (-6.81 → Mate in 5) Checkmate is now unavoidable. Qd4 was best. } { [%eval #-5] } (53. Qd4 Rh2 54. Qa4+ Rxa4 55. Kxh2 Ra2+ 56. Kg1 d4 57. Kf1 d3 58. Ke1 Rg2) 53... Rh2 { [%eval #-4] } 54. Be3 { [%eval #-3] } 54... Rh1+ { [%eval #-2] } 55. Bg1 { [%eval #-2] } 55... Bg2+ { [%eval #-1] } 56. Ke1 { [%eval #-1] } 56... Rxg1# { Black wins by checkmate. } 0-1